Higher Quality Materials

Mild steel is fairly common in automobile production when it comes to exhaust components. It's fine, but it tends to deteriorate over time. This can lead to exhaust leaks and performance issues the longer you own the vehicle.

Improved Fuel Economy

This can be a tricky subject when it comes to custom exhausts. The more efficient your exhaust system is, the more efficient your engine will run. This typically leads to better fuel mileage.

Many custom and kit exhausts are designed specifically with this in mind. Some will boost the torque and horsepower so much, however, that it has the opposite effect. 

The engine has to burn more fuel to keep up with the increased power output. A good custom exhaust system can help you find the right balance between performance and fuel economy, but ultimately it's up to you.
